Our first session tackles one of the most practical questions facing advisers today: when does an SMA work, and when does an MDA work better?

Industry experts will compare Separately Managed Accounts and Managed Discretionary Accounts, examining which structure best supports your clients’ needs and your firm’s business model.

Jacqueline Fernley, Founder of arcpoint OCIO, will share insights into client outcomes, efficiency, compliance and governance, drawing on her experience across institutional investment management and OCIO strategy.

Andy Robertson, Chief Innovation Officer at Chelmer, will demonstrate how firms can automate portfolio management across both SMA and MDA structures – scaling advice delivery without scaling headcount.

The session will be moderated by Leanne Bradley, Co-CEO of Suite2Go.

Key topics will include

SMA vs MDA: understanding which structure best supports your clients and your business model

Client outcomes, governance and compliance considerations across both approaches

How technology enables firms to automate portfolio management at scale

Practical strategies for scaling advice delivery across SMA and MDA structures
